The Significance of a Cooling System in a Massage Gun
Massage guns work by delivering rapid and repetitive percussive strokes to the muscles. This high - intensity operation generates a substantial amount of heat. Without an efficient cooling system, the internal components of the massage gun can overheat. Overheating not only reduces the lifespan of the motor and other parts but also can lead to a decrease in performance. For instance, an overheated motor may lose power, resulting in weaker massage strokes. Moreover, it can pose a safety risk, as extremely high temperatures can potentially cause burns to the user.
Types of Cooling Systems in Massage Guns
Air Cooling
Air cooling is one of the most common cooling methods used in massage guns. This system typically consists of a fan that draws in cool air from the outside and blows it over the internal components, such as the motor. The heat is then dissipated through vents in the massage gun's casing.
The advantage of air cooling is its simplicity and cost - effectiveness. It is relatively easy to implement, and the fans used are generally reliable. However, air cooling may not be as efficient in high - demand situations. When the massage gun is used for an extended period or at high speeds, the amount of heat generated may exceed the cooling capacity of the air cooling system.

Liquid Cooling
Liquid cooling is a more advanced and efficient cooling method. In a liquid - cooled massage gun, a coolant (usually a special liquid with high heat - transfer properties) circulates through channels near the heat - generating components. The coolant absorbs the heat and then transfers it to a radiator, where it is dissipated into the surrounding air.
Liquid cooling offers several benefits. It can handle much higher heat loads compared to air cooling, making it ideal for high - performance massage guns. This means that the massage gun can operate at high speeds for longer periods without overheating. Additionally, liquid cooling is often quieter than air cooling, as the fans used in air - cooled systems can be quite noisy.

Hybrid Cooling
Hybrid cooling combines the advantages of both air and liquid cooling. It uses a liquid - cooling system to handle the majority of the heat generated by the motor and other components, while an air - cooling system provides additional cooling and helps to maintain a stable temperature.
This approach offers the best of both worlds. It can effectively cool the massage gun even under extreme conditions, ensuring consistent performance and a long service life. Factors to Consider in a Good Cooling System
Cooling Efficiency
The primary function of a cooling system is to keep the massage gun's internal components at a safe operating temperature. A good cooling system should be able to dissipate heat quickly and efficiently, even when the massage gun is used intensively. Look for massage guns with high - capacity fans in air - cooled systems or well - designed liquid - cooling circuits in liquid - cooled and hybrid - cooled models.
Noise Level
A noisy cooling system can be a major drawback, especially for a gift item. Some air - cooled systems may produce a loud humming sound when the fan is running at high speeds. Liquid - cooled and hybrid - cooled systems generally tend to be quieter, as the liquid - cooling process is more silent. When choosing a massage gun, consider the noise level of its cooling system to ensure a pleasant user experience.
Durability
The cooling system should be durable enough to withstand regular use. Components such as fans, pumps (in liquid - cooled systems), and radiators should be of high quality. A well - built cooling system will not only last longer but also require less maintenance over time.
